  • Jordon
    Origin of the name Jordan: Derived from the Hebrew yarden (to flow down, descend). The name is that of the chief river of Palestine, in which Jesus was baptized. Jordan originated as a given name in the Middle Ages, being bestowed upon those baptized in holy water said to be taken from the Jordan River.
    Meaning: Descend, Flow down Origin: Hebrew

  • Iordan
    From the name of the river which flows between the countries of Jordan and Israel. The river's name in Hebrew is יַרְדֵן (Yarden), and it is derived from יָרַד (yarad) meaning "descend" or "flow down". ... This name died out after the Middle Ages, but was revived in the 19th century.
    Meaning: To flow down, descend
